720p/60 footage stutters in Premiere Pro Cs5

Hello: I have recently purchased a NX5U and Adobe Premiere Pro CS5. Prem Pro plays and edits raw 1080p/24 footage very well. However, when playing/editing 720p/60 recordings, it jumps/stutters about every 2 seconds. In comparison, I played/edited the same recording in Final Cut Express. FCE played the clips just fine (of course after waiting for log/transfer of raw file). If anyone has any wisdom to share, please guide me. Thank you.

The processor isn't powerful enough to decode and play the 720P60 AVCHD file smoothly. You will need a more powerful machine to play all the AVCHD files native.

It is not a lot more data crunching but is likely enough to make a difference. For 720P60 the computer has to decode 60 frames a second but for 24P only 24 frames a second. Although the total number of pixels decoded is only a little more for 720P60 it has to be in at 60 frames a second. There is only 1/60 sec for the computer to decode. For 24p there is more than twice as long for the computer to decode each frame.
